What should I know about IP ratings and weather resistance when selecting floodlight accessory parts?
IP ratings show how well floodlight accessory parts resist dust and water, guiding outdoor use. IP66 protects against powerful water jets, while IP67 allows temporary immersion; choose based on exposure. Material and sealing quality impact long-term durability, with aluminum or reinforced plastics offering better heat dissipation and corrosion resistance. Ensure the accessory parts match the fixture design and the intended environment to maintain performance and warranty.

How can I mount and maintain floodlight accessory parts to ensure lasting performance?
Use weatherproof mounting brackets that match the fixture's pattern and corrosion-resistant fasteners. Seal joints with appropriate gaskets or silicone to prevent moisture ingress, and regularly inspect seals for wear. Clean lenses and housings with mild soap and water, avoiding abrasive cleaners. For solar-powered units, keep connectors and panels clean and intact, following manufacturer recommendations for maintenance.
How do brightness and color temperature influence the choice of floodlight accessory parts for different spaces?
Brightness (lumens) should align with area size and task requirements, with larger outdoor spaces needing more lumens for adequate illumination. Color temperature affects visibility and mood; cooler temperatures (roughly 4000–6500K) enhance clarity and security. Choose accessories that support the desired lumen output and ensure proper thermal management to avoid performance drop. Verify compatibility with the fixture’s driver and power source to maintain efficiency.
